Re: Parcelhawk webhook retry logic. New folks: the carrier pushes duplicate scan events, so dedupe on event hash before enqueueing. Don't widen the retry window without checking queue depth first — Dovetail Couriers batches overnight and we've melted the worker pool twice. Backoff is exponential with jitter, capped. The constants we tuned after the Brindlemoor incident are below.

tuning table, kajog-bawip:
TIERS = {
    "kelius": 256,
    "lammir": 543,
}

### Account Recovery — Catalogue Import (Lintwood)

Quick one for review: when the Lintwood catalogue import wipes a patron's session table, the recovery flow re-seeds accounts from the nightly snapshot. Check that the importer skips locked accounts — last time it didn't. To rerun recovery against staging you'll need the vault passphrase, which is appended just below.

recovery phrase for yafof-tajof: julmir-kelax-julvan-holath-belvan-holir-ralael-ralvan-ralath-julvan-silmir-istmir-kaswyn-ulamir

Subject: On-call handover — tailcat CLI

Hey, quick handover before you take the pager. The internal log-tailing CLI (tailcat) has been flaky since the Brimworth cluster upgrade — it sometimes drops the stream after ~10 minutes, so don't panic if your tail goes quiet; just reconnect with the `--resume` flag. Known issue, fix is in review. Config lives in `~/.tailcat/profile`; copy mine from the shared runbook if yours is missing. Since you're new as a contractor: access requests and any tooling questions should go to the address below.

escalation mailbox, bafog-fafog: ulador@paliqlabs.internal